Experiences of a nature-based intervention program in a northern natural setting: A longitudinal case study of two women with stress-related illness.

Gunilla JohanssonÅsa EngströmPäivi Juuso
Published in: International journal of qualitative studies on health and well-being (2022)
Nature-based interventions lasting for a relatively short period seem to promote health and may be a complement to other treatments of stress-related illness. Further research is needed with a larger number of participants and in various natural settings.
